This chart shows that the number of threads varies largely between day and night, with more<br />

and lighter threads during the day. Storage per thread stays more or less constant at 1 MB<br />

each during normal working hours.<br />

Figure 4-11 shows in detail how the memory per thread varies by time of day. Overnight there<br />

are fewer threads but they each have a larger footprint. In general each daytime thread (when<br />

the demand <strong>for</strong> virtual storage is at its highest) has a footprint of about 1 MB.<br />

It is useful to calculate the storage per thread so that thread limits such as CTHREAD can be<br />

properly set. This picture can be further refined using IFCID 217 thread-level data.<br />
